– Costa Rica’s most sought-after bartender, Canadian expat Liz Furlong, creates cocktail menus that draw from native Central American ingredients.

– Lawyer Don Cornwell claims he has discovered the “smoking gun” that links Hong Kong auction house Dragon 8 to notorious wine counterfeiter Rudy Kurniawan.

– Winemakers, sommeliers, collectors and industry veterans recall the moment they fell in love with wine.

– A stage adaptation of the Oscar-winning comedy Sideways makes its debut on May 26 in London’s West End.

– In Delaware, Dogfish Head hopes to attract beer lovers with its Dogfish Inn, a 16-room boutique hotel located near the brewery.

– Finally, from Thin Mints to Samoas, Kevin Hart—the sommelier, not the actor—explains how to pair Girl Scout Cookies with wine.
